PewDiePie is no longer the number one content creator on YouTube. The Swedish influencer, who has been squatting in the top spot since 2013, loses a rank to MrBeast; according to the latest score from Dexerto. The specialized site has published on Monday a video showing the moment when MrBeast’s counter skyrockets to overtake PewDiePie’s subscriber count.
That day, the American content creator exceeded the 111,851,893 subscribers on its main channel. He is ahead of his Swedish counterpart, who made a name for himself by filming his video game games, by several thousand fans. The following day, on Twitter, YouTube congratulated the one that brings in the most subscribers to; the video platform with a simple “congrats@MrBeast”.
111,111,111 subscribers on November 11
MrBeast had fun the alignment of the digits. “What are the chances that I randomly open YouTube? 111,111,111 subscribers to; 11:11 p.m. exactly on November 11?”, the American wrote on Twitter. A little later, he indicated that he had bought 1,111 lottery tickets, imagining he was going to win.

Mr Beast, aka Jimmy Donaldson, who dreams “ of’ to be Elon (Musk) one day”, has been active on YouTube since 2012. Last July, he had been the second youtuber & agrave; exceed 100 million subscribers. A level that he had reached much faster than PewDiePie.
54 millions of dollars in 2021
Lover of challenges, the 24-year-old American sees things big. Last year, he distinguished himself; by launching a competition comparable to Squid Game, the Netflix series to be success; relates BFMTV.
In 2021, MrBeast had pocketed; 54 million dollars, or nearly 52 million euros. At $5 million a month, it’s the highest paid content creator in the world. from YouTube.
